Abstract

The utility model discloses a stainless steel heat preservation cup body polishing device, which comprises a workbench, wherein one side of the inner wall of the workbench is provided with a first slide rail, both ends of the inner wall of the first slide rail are respectively provided with a slide block in a sliding way, one side of the inner wall of the first slide rail is provided with a through groove, one side of the outer wall of the workbench is provided with a second slide rail, one end of the inner wall of the second slide rail is provided with a support plate in a sliding way, the top of the support plate is fixedly provided with a speed reducing motor, the output end of the speed reducing motor is fixedly provided with a first rotating shaft, one end of the surface of the first rotating shaft is connected with one end of the inner wall of the through groove in an alternating way, the other end of the surface of the first rotating shaft is connected with one side of one of the slide block in an alternating way, the utility model jointly forms a sliding mechanism by arranging the first slide rail, the through groove, the second slide rail, the support plate, the slide block and the limiting plate, so that a polishing roller wheel positioned outside the workbench can enter the interior of the workbench to facilitate transportation, and is more beautiful.

Background
The thermos cup is a water container made of stainless steel and a vacuum layer, a cover is arranged at the top of the thermos cup, the thermos cup is tightly sealed, the vacuum heat insulation layer can delay heat dissipation of water and other liquid in the thermos cup so as to achieve the purpose of heat preservation, a plurality of layers are arranged in the thermos cup, an interlayer of the thermos cup is generally vacuum, heat conduction is prevented, silver is plated, heat radiation can be prevented, a cork is arranged on a cup cover, heat conduction is prevented, winter season of the thermos cup is good, polishing is an important process in the processing process of the thermos cup, and a polishing machine is needed.
The polishing of the prior polishing machine is finished, the polishing belt wheel is arranged outside the polishing machine, the polishing belt wheel is quite baffled, the polishing machine is not attractive enough, the conveying machine is also easily damaged in the process, and after the polishing is finished, a plurality of polishing chips remain in the machine, the polishing belt wheel is not easy to clean, the performance of the machine is damaged due to long-time accumulation, the service life of the machine is shortened, and therefore the polishing device for the stainless steel heat-preservation cup body, which is convenient to convey and clean, is urgently needed.

The utility model discloses a technological effect and advantage:
(1) the polishing device is characterized in that a sliding mechanism is formed by arranging a first slide rail, a through groove, a second slide rail, a supporting plate, sliders and limiting plates together, after polishing is completed, the two limiting plates are pulled out, the limitation on the two sliders is respectively removed, the supporting plate slides backwards along the second slide rail, a speed reduction motor positioned at the top of the supporting plate drives a first rotating shaft to move, the first rotating shaft drives one of the sliders to slide towards the inside of a workbench along the first slide rail, and a polishing roller wheel inserted on the surface of the first rotating shaft drives the other polishing roller wheel and the slider to slide towards the inside of the workbench through a polishing belt, so that the polishing roller wheel positioned outside the workbench enters the inside of the workbench, thereby facilitating transportation and being more attractive;
(2) through setting up the fan, apron and magnetic sheet constitute clean mechanism jointly, rotate the apron, make it cover the workstation openly, later start the fan, blow to the magnetic sheet surface with the inside piece of workstation, because the piece is not bits steel material, thereby can be held the piece to workstation inside by the magnetic sheet and assemble, later with the apron change to the workstation top and clear up its surface adsorption's piece, this mechanism is clean thoroughly, the practicality is good.

The utility model discloses the theory of operation: after polishing, the two limiting plates 10 are pulled out, the limitation on the two sliders 7 is respectively removed, then the supporting plate 5 slides backwards along the second slide rail 4, the speed reducing motor 6 positioned at the top of the supporting plate 5 drives the first rotating shaft 8 to move, the first rotating shaft 8 drives one of the sliders 7 to slide towards the inside of the workbench 1 along the first slide rail 2, the polishing roller 14 inserted in the surface of the first rotating shaft 8 drives the other polishing roller 14 and the slider 7 to slide towards the inside of the workbench 1 through the polishing belt 15, so that the polishing roller 14 positioned outside the workbench 1 enters the workbench 1, then the cover plate 12 is rotated to cover the front surface of the workbench 1, then the fan 11 is started to blow the debris inside the workbench 1 to the surface of the magnetic plate 13, the debris is not scrap steel material and can be sucked by the magnetic plate 13 to gather the debris inside the workbench 1, then the cover plate 12 is rotated to the top of the workbench 1 to clean the debris adsorbed on the surface, the cover plate 12 covers the front surface of the workbench 1, thereby facilitating transportation.
